Box Score 2 ABILENE, Texas -- Hardin-Simmons' softball team dropped a pair of American Southwest Conference games to Louisiana College on Friday afternoon at Ellis Field.
Game 1
Savannah Settle tossed a four-hit shutout for Louisiana College in the first game. She walked one and struck out three.
Shea Smith had an RBI single to break up a scoreless game in the fourth, Taylor Hammock had an RBI single in the fifth and a run scored on a passed ball in the seventh.
Lexie Allen worked the first three and two-third innings and allowed just one run but fell to 3-5.
Genia Jones worked the final three and one-third innings.
Kirsten Kenyon had two of the four hits for the Cowgirls. Shelby Bergeron and Taylor Hammock had two hits each for the Wildcats.
Game 2
In the second game, Hammock had an RBI single and Jordan Mason added a two-run single in the third inning. In the fifth inning Hammock had a sacrifice fly and Mason added an RBI single.
Darian Thacker (5-0) worked five shutout innings and Chelsea Lewis worked the final two innings for Louisiana College.
Chloe Brignac allowed five runs on eight hits to fall to 3-3 on the year.
KeAmbria Hunter had two of the seven hits for HSU and Mattie Stine had three hits for LC.
HSU is now 7-11 on the year and 4-10 in ASC play. Louisiana College improved to 16-2 overall and 13-1 in conference action. The teams will conclude the series with an 11 a.m. game on Saturday.
